I am 35 pages into Improv Wisdom by Patricia Ryan Meadows and I've already found something that we whole heartedly agree on. That something is to be open.
Patricia doesn't come right out and say "be open" (at least not in the the first 35 pages) but it is clear as day. To be successful at improv you must be receptive to what the other actor(s) are giving you. If you're closed you miss opportunities and stifle the creative process. Not just for yourself, but for all those around you. That's why Patricia's first maxim of improv is "say yes". Yes is open.
I've found the same goes in life. When I'm open, it's amazing what opportunities come along. All of a sudden an uncle's friend becomes a key member of Techmate or a neighbor's recommendation to try Muay Thai becomes a welcome change and a healthy obsession.
Being open makes the world an opportunity.
